The old shares were held by the company that is being liquidated;The Rangers Football Club Public Limited Company,the former owners of the club. Any investmernt under Green will be into The Rangers International Football Club PLC,who will become the owners of the club. And before we get this new club,old club crap,i have my wifes' share certificate in front of me,stating The Rangers Football Club PLC under the common seal of the Company.. The old shares under The Rangers Football Club PLC are now or are about to be defunct after formal liquidation of the PLC. Anyone that is investing is investing in the Company that operates the business,the business in this case being football. 0 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...

From the BBC website - David Limond arrested over Rangers fans website remarks A man has been arrested in South Ayrshire over alleged offensive remarks on a Rangers supporters website. BBC Scotland understands David Limond was held in Ayr on Friday morning by officers from Strathclyde Police's major crime and terrorism unit. The 40-year-old was charged under the Criminal Justice and Licensing (Scotland) Act 2010. Mr Limond was released on an undertaking to appear in court at a later date. He is expected to appear at at Rothesay Sheriff Court on 7 January next year in relation to the alleged incident. A police spokeswoman said: "On Friday 14 December 2012, officers from Strathclyde Police's major crime and terrorism unit detained and arrested a 40-year-old man in relation to alleged remarks made online. "He was charged under the Criminal Justice Licensing (Scotland) Act 2010. The man was later released on an undertaking." 0 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
